Are debit cards for kids a good idea?
Debit cards can be a valuable tool for teaching kids about finance through hands-on experience. If you want your kid or teen to understand the importance of saving money and spending responsibly, opening their own debit card can be a wise decision. Most kids and teen debit card accounts offer financial literacy tools in-app, as well as chore and allowance features and the ability to set savings goals.
Plus, with most kids’ debit cards, parents have complete control and can set up spending limits, monitor balances, receive notifications and even lock cards entirely.
